技术困境:旧设备面临的系统兼容挑战
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
在Apple的生态系统更新策略下,无数性能完好的Mac设备被迫"退休"。用户常常面临这样的困境:硬件依然强劲,但系统版本却被锁定在多年前的水平。这不仅影响日常使用体验,更带来安全问题和功能缺失。
典型问题表现:
- 无法安装新版软件和系统更新
- 安全问题无法得到及时修复
- 现代生产力工具无法正常使用
- 与周边设备的连接兼容性受限
解决方案:OpenCore Legacy Patcher的技术原理
OpenCore Legacy Patcher作为开源解决方案,通过创新的技术手段突破Apple的系统限制。其核心机制在于构建定制的OpenCore引导环境,为旧硬件提供新版macOS的系统兼容支持。
图1:OpenCore配置构建界面,展示自动添加驱动和补丁的过程,实现macOS版本支持
技术优势:
- 自动适配不同硬件配置
- 提供完整的驱动和补丁支持
- 保持系统稳定性和安全性
- 解锁隐藏功能,提升用户体验
实战操作:从零开始的完整安装指南
第一步:环境准备与工具获取
目标:准备安装所需的软硬件环境 操作:从官方仓库克隆项目并检查系统要求 预期结果:获得完整的项目文件并确认设备兼容性
第二步:构建OpenCore引导配置
目标:创建定制化的OpenCore EFI环境 操作:在图形界面中选择设备型号和配置选项 预期结果:生成完整的OpenCore配置文件和必要的内核扩展
图2:OpenCore构建完成确认界面,显示成功生成配置文件,确保系统兼容
第三步:制作macOS安装介质
目标:创建可引导的macOS安装盘 操作:下载系统镜像并写入USB设备 预期结果:获得完整的安装启动盘
第四步:系统安装与根卷补丁
目标:安装新版macOS并应用硬件补丁 操作:通过启动盘引导安装系统,完成后运行根卷补丁 预期结果:成功运行新版macOS并修复硬件兼容问题
图3:macOS系统镜像下载过程,显示详细的进度信息,保障macOS版本支持
效果验证:实际应用案例分析
案例一:2015款iMac的系统升级
升级前状态:
- 运行macOS Catalina系统
- 无法使用Sidecar等新功能
- 安全更新支持即将结束
升级后效果:
- 成功运行macOS Sonoma
- 所有硬件功能正常工作
- 解锁Universal Control等高级功能
案例二:2014款MacBook Pro的性能提升
升级前限制:
- 系统版本锁定在High Sierra
- 现代软件兼容性差
- 系统性能逐渐下降
改善成果:
- 系统响应速度提升明显
- 支持最新生产力工具
- 延长设备使用寿命3-5年
图4:OpenCore Legacy Patcher主界面,展示四大核心功能模块,实现完整的系统兼容支持
深度探索:高级功能与优化配置
内核扩展管理
OpenCore Legacy Patcher智能管理各类内核扩展,确保系统稳定运行。通过Lilu框架协调不同扩展之间的兼容性,避免冲突和系统崩溃。
系统安全配置
在提供macOS版本支持的同时,工具确保系统安全机制正常运行。通过精细调整系统完整性保护(SIP)和Apple Mobile File Integrity(AMFI)设置,平衡功能与安全性。
图5:根卷补丁完成界面,显示所有补丁步骤已执行完毕,完成系统兼容优化
故障排除:常见问题解决方案
问题一:构建过程中断
- 检查网络连接稳定性
- 验证Python环境完整性
- 确认磁盘空间充足
问题二:安装后硬件不工作
- 运行根卷补丁功能
- 检查特定硬件补丁是否应用
- 查看构建日志排查具体问题
问题三:系统启动失败
- 验证EFI配置是否正确
- 检查内核扩展兼容性
- 重新生成OpenCore配置
技术展望:未来发展方向
OpenCore Legacy Patcher作为开源社区的杰出成果,展现了技术创新的无限可能。随着Apple生态的持续演进,这类工具将在设备生命周期管理、可持续计算等领域发挥更大价值。
核心价值总结:
- 延长硬件使用寿命,减少电子垃圾
- 降低用户升级成本,提升使用体验
- 推动技术普惠,让更多人享受科技进步的成果
通过OpenCore Legacy Patcher,旧款Mac设备重获新生不再是梦想。这个工具不仅解决了技术层面的兼容问题,更体现了开源社区的技术担当和创新精神。
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考